What does The Meep do?
The Meep is a Legendary Creature — Alien. Its Oracle text reads: "Ward—Pay 3 life. Whenever The Meep attacks, you may sacrifice another creature. If you do, creatures you control have base power and toughness X/X until end of turn, where X is the sacrificed creature's mana value." — view the full Oracle text on Scryfall.
What type of card is The Meep?
The Meep is a Legendary Creature — Alien. It is a Rare card from the Secret Lair Drop set.
What format is The Meep legal in?
The Meep is legal in: Legacy, Vintage, Commander. Learn more about Legacy format in our wiki.
